  1. I am quite suprised that a Tramadol is named non-opioid drug. It is for sure atypical centrally-acting drug, but (+)-Tramadol and metabolite (+)-O-desmethyl-tramadol (M1) are agonists of the mu opioid receptor.
  2. ..."The aim of this research was to characterize the drug utilization for pain management during perioperative period of TKA in China by using real world data, and to analyze the association between drug utilization and perioperative characteristics. The results of this study are expected to provide a reference for the future development of guidelines for the use of perioperative analgesics in TKA."...- what the point is in showing what drugs are used without any correlations with efficacy? Are there any data for VAS/NRS scores pre and post TKA? How the data presentad will influence a future development of the guidelines?
  3. The different drug utilization modes are showed in the manuscript- mostly combined. But there is no information how the drugs were administered in a time manner- all together? one after one?. There is a suggestion in one or two sentences, that in some combinations the drugs were administered simultaneously (lines 211, 216). In the situation of eg. celecoxib+parecoxib it seems like medical mistake- same mechanism of action, no additional analgesic effect, much more potential adverse effects. In the work of Zhuang Q et al there is nothing, which can support such a "same time combination" (Reference 31)- firstly it is just description of the protocol of the study to be done, secondly in the protocol iv parecoxib will be followed by oral celecoxib (not simultaneously).

Reply 1: Thank you for your important comment.

We have added more explanations about tramadol in the method and discussion section, as well as a comparison of studies on tramadol as a weak opioid, which is enough to emphasize that it is classified as a non-opioid drug in this study to avoid misunderstanding.

Tramadol was classified as a non-opioid central analgesic rather than a weak opioid according to expert consensus in this study.”(line 124-126

In previous studies, tramadol was classified as a weak opioid agonist with two mechanisms of action[1]. And in some study, tramadol was identified as an atypical opioid distinct from opioids[2]. In this study, tramadol was classified as a non-opioid central analgesic based on existing expert consensus in China, which is a reflection of real-world drug utilization method in China and was therefore adopted.(line 210-215)

 

  1. I will be insisting on putting more attention to potential harmful reactions of drug-drug combinations (with the same mode of action, especially NSAIDs) administered simultaneously. As you are not aware, how the drugs were administered (due to data base limitation) it should be strongly highlighted. You have changed that part of discussion, and it sounds much better, whatsoever I think that you should complement that part.

Reply 2: Thank you for your insightful comment.

We have added more content has been added to highlight the possible hazards of concomitant use of drugs with the same mechanism of action.

“For instance, "celecoxib + parecoxib" was the most common mode of combined drug use, and 29 patients used Sufentanil and Remifentanil at the same time in Mode 3, both of which had the same mechanism of action. Although, there is some evidence showed that if iv parecoxib followed by oral celecoxib in different period after TKA surgery may decrease the use of morphine [3]. However, in a study analyzing international reports of adverse reactions, celecoxib was found to pose a greater risk of adverse reactions when used in combination with other NSAIDs, such as gastrointestinal side effects, renal and urinary disorders, and hypertension [4]. One study also confirmed a higher risk of gastrointestinal bleeding with the combination of different NSAIDs [5]. So, it is still necessary to be vigilant when using drugs with the same mechanism of action during perioperative period and needs further exploration [6].” (line 223-233)

Please explain what was meant by local anesthesia – in general, neuraxial anesthesia is the standardized term for spinal or epidural anesthesia, peripheral nerve block is used for when a particular peripheral nerve is blocked by administering local anesthetics. Local anesthesia refers to local anesthetic infiltration by surgeons.
